import { describe, test, expect } from "bun:test"
import {
createAgentToolRestrictions,
createAgentToolAllowlist,
migrateToolsToPermission,
migrateAgentConfig,
} from "./permission-compat"
describe("permission-compat", () => {
describe("createAgentToolRestrictions", () => {
test("returns permission format with deny values", () => {
// given tools to restrict
// when creating restrictions
const result = createAgentToolRestrictions(["write", "edit"])
// then returns permission format
expect(result).toEqual({
permission: { write: "deny", edit: "deny" },
})
})
test("returns empty permission for empty array", () => {
// given empty tools array
// when creating restrictions
const result = createAgentToolRestrictions([])
// then returns empty permission
expect(result).toEqual({ permission: {} })
})
})
describe("createAgentToolAllowlist", () => {
test("returns wildcard deny with explicit allow", () => {
// given tools to allow
// when creating allowlist
const result = createAgentToolAllowlist(["read"])
// then returns wildcard deny with read allow
expect(result).toEqual({
permission: { "*": "deny", read: "allow" },
})
})
test("returns wildcard deny with multiple allows", () => {
// given multiple tools to allow
// when creating allowlist
const result = createAgentToolAllowlist(["read", "glob"])
// then returns wildcard deny with both allows
expect(result).toEqual({
permission: { "*": "deny", read: "allow", glob: "allow" },
})
})
})
describe("migrateToolsToPermission", () => {
test("converts boolean tools to permission values", () => {
// given tools config
const tools = { write: false, edit: true, bash: false }
// when migrating
const result = migrateToolsToPermission(tools)
// then converts correctly
expect(result).toEqual({
write: "deny",
edit: "allow",
bash: "deny",
})
})
})
describe("migrateAgentConfig", () => {
test("migrates tools to permission", () => {
// given config with tools
const config = {
model: "test",
tools: { write: false, edit: false },
}
// when migrating
const result = migrateAgentConfig(config)
// then converts to permission
expect(result.tools).toBeUndefined()
expect(result.permission).toEqual({ write: "deny", edit: "deny" })
expect(result.model).toBe("test")
})
test("preserves other config fields", () => {
// given config with other fields
const config = {
model: "test",
temperature: 0.5,
prompt: "hello",
tools: { write: false },
}
// when migrating
const result = migrateAgentConfig(config)
// then preserves other fields
expect(result.model).toBe("test")
expect(result.temperature).toBe(0.5)
expect(result.prompt).toBe("hello")
})
test("merges existing permission with migrated tools", () => {
// given config with both tools and permission
const config = {
tools: { write: false },
permission: { bash: "deny" as const },
}
// when migrating
const result = migrateAgentConfig(config)
// then merges permission (existing takes precedence)
expect(result.tools).toBeUndefined()
expect(result.permission).toEqual({ write: "deny", bash: "deny" })
})
test("returns unchanged config if no tools", () => {
// given config without tools
const config = { model: "test", permission: { edit: "deny" as const } }
// when migrating
const result = migrateAgentConfig(config)
// then returns unchanged
expect(result).toEqual(config)
})
test("migrates delegate_task permission to task", () => {
//#given config with delegate_task permission
const config = {
model: "test",
permission: { delegate_task: "allow" as const, write: "deny" as const },
}
//#when migrating
const result = migrateAgentConfig(config)
//#then delegate_task is renamed to task
const perm = result.permission as Record<string, string>
expect(perm["task"]).toBe("allow")
expect(perm["delegate_task"]).toBeUndefined()
expect(perm["write"]).toBe("deny")
})
test("does not overwrite existing task permission with delegate_task", () => {
//#given config with both task and delegate_task permissions
const config = {
permission: { delegate_task: "allow" as const, task: "deny" as const },
}
//#when migrating
const result = migrateAgentConfig(config)
//#then existing task permission is preserved
const perm = result.permission as Record<string, string>
expect(perm["task"]).toBe("deny")
expect(perm["delegate_task"]).toBe("allow")
})
test("does not mutate the original config permission object", () => {
//#given config with delegate_task permission
const originalPerm = { delegate_task: "allow" as const }
const config = { permission: originalPerm }
//#when migrating
migrateAgentConfig(config)
//#then original permission object is not mutated
expect(originalPerm).toEqual({ delegate_task: "allow" })
})
})
})
